Who Is Almost Real?

Almost Real is a Hong Kong-founded diecast house that built its reputation on 1:64 scale replicas with an unusually high bar for accuracy. Rather than chasing volume, the brand focuses on getting the details right: correct panel lines, faithful livery reproduction, and finishes that hold up under close inspection. Their catalogue leans heavily into two worlds that Indian collectors love — hypercar and motorsport icons (Porsche, Pagani, Mercedes-AMG) and off-road expedition vehicles, most famously the Land Rover Defender in its many historic guises.

What Makes the AR Box Different

Almost Real ships its models in a distinctive branded AR Box rather than a generic blister pack. For collectors who care about shelf presentation or plan to keep pieces mint-in-box, this is a meaningful difference from mass-market packaging. It's part of why Almost Real pieces tend to hold their value well in the secondary collector market.
